That would take some serious space planning! ;) > (Yes, I'm trying to be sarcastic.) > SMS Ok, well more on the story of the nice-racks.com stuff. I talked by email with David Tatelbaum at nice-racks and he was very prompt with answers (a good sign). We exchanged several emails discussing requirements, stain colors, measurements and such. I ordered a 16 space, 12-inch deep, special-walnut color stained, handles included, along with a special measurement 1/4 inch recess install of the rails. The total cost including shipping is about $132 bucks. I can expect the rack in about two to three weeks. When it arrives I will report back on what I think of it. Currently I have a 16 space Raxxess economy rack I had to put together myself. It is 16 inches deep and takes up way too much room and does not look that nice. The nice-racks rack will be stuffed with FracRaks of Paia and Blacet modules and it will sit next to (hopefully) a Stooge Enterprise solid walnut MOTM cabinet. Andy
